Transaction 77a8106a78f08db5afd33f8c086146e7912b533c3b5852eb61acc003cc97eba6

1 Input
2 Outputs
  • 77a8106a78f08db5afd33f8c086146e7912b533c3b5852eb61acc003cc97eba6:0
  • value  9352000
    address  16gL23BWkBvGTQhJaxy3LaVh1Ve17uGpoN
  • 77a8106a78f08db5afd33f8c086146e7912b533c3b5852eb61acc003cc97eba6:1
  • value  41143177
    address  1L33mTifuL3esVYSTsCC7peraUTxtuWSQL